1998 Explorer XLT 4.0 sohc 5r55e 1354 manual 1982 Jeep Wagoneer Dana 44 front axle 4.88:1 Yukon gears Detroit Truetrac Passenger side flat top knuckle (73-76 Chevy) milled and drilled by Sky Mfg Passenger side Sky Mfg tall high steer arm Small bearing spindles (73-76 Chevy) 5x5.5 hubs, rotors and wheel bearings (Ford Dana 44 ttb) Stock rear axle 4.88:1 Yukon gears Detroit locker Spidertrax 5x4.5 to 5x5.5 wheel spacers 1997 Ranger steering box 1997 (I think) Steering shaft (has 98+ connection at firewall and rag joint at steering box) Jeep Wagoneer pitman arm (had to retaper splines) 1.5x0.25 wall DOM tie rod and draglink Ballistic Fab weld in bungs Parts Mike EX2234R and EX2234L tie rod ends 1995 Bronco...

Fortunately for me, this worked out well with no kinks I can think of. - Low Pinion Dana 44 from 2001 Dodge Ram shortened to use Wagoneer left & right inner shafts with stock Ram outer shafts. The good - Stock Ram Dual piston calipers 12" rotors - Chrome moly inner axle shafts - Low pinion chunk with great clearance to frame - Sealed hubs, 4x4 on demand, no more regreasing bearings, nut torquing etc. - Custom Radius arm design allowing me to unbolt passenger upper arm for 3 link radius arm or wristed arm setup for more articulation.
